As two players shot their way into contention for top individual honors, the Oklahoma State women’s golf team positioned themselves for another trip to nationals after the second round of the NCAA Women’s Golf Chapel Hill Regional on Tuesday. The Cowgirls moved from a tie for fourth place after the first round into third place by themselves after a second-round total of 3-over-par. Even though it was OSU’s second straight day over par as a team, the field spaced out and the Cowgirls found themselves in good position to advance to the NCAA Championships later this month. OSU is nine shots ahead of sixth-place Virginia, which is important because the top five teams at the end of the third round on Wednesday advance to the NCAA championship tournament from May 22-27 at the Omni La Costa Resort and Spa in Carlsbad, Calif. Meanwhile, two Cowgirls went under-par on Tuesday and put themselves in the Top 5 entering the final round.…
